区块链游戏中的原理区块链游戏中的原理
区块链游戏中的原理
本文目录:
随着区块链技术的迅速发展,区块链游戏作为一种新兴的娱乐形式,逐渐受到广泛关注,区块链游戏结合了区块链的去中心化、不可篡改性和分布式账本等特性,为游戏行业带来了全新的可能性,本文将从区块链的基本原理出发,探讨区块链游戏中的核心机制及其应用。
区块链的基本原理
区块链是一种分布式账本系统,通过密码学算法和共识机制实现数据的不可篡改性和透明性,其核心原理包括以下几个方面:
- 数据记录:区块链通过链式结构将数据块连接起来,每个数据块包含一定数量的交易记录或状态更新,这些数据块通过哈希函数进行加密,确保其不可篡改。
- 分布式账本:区块链的数据由多个节点共同维护,每个节点都有一份完整的账本副本,这种设计确保了数据的去中心化和不可篡改性。
- 共识机制:区块链网络需要达成共识来确认交易的正确性,常见的共识机制包括工作量证明(PoW)、权益证明(PoS)和可变种(DPoS),这些机制确保了网络的稳定性和安全性。
- 不可篡改性:由于区块链的不可逆性和分布式特性,任何试图篡改区块链数据的行为都会被网络节点发现并拒绝。
- 去中心化:区块链不需要中央机构或信任节点来维护网络的正常运行,所有节点都是平等的参与者。
区块链游戏的核心机制
区块链游戏通过将区块链技术与游戏相结合,利用区块链的特性为游戏增加新的玩法和价值,以下是区块链游戏的核心机制:
- 智能合约:智能合约是区块链技术的重要组成部分,它是一个自执行的合同,无需人工干预,在区块链游戏中,智能合约可以用于自动执行游戏规则、结算奖励或转移虚拟资产。
- 非交互式证明(NIZK):区块链游戏中的智能合约需要验证玩家的行为是否符合游戏规则,非交互式证明是一种无需交互的证明方法,在区块链上高效验证玩家的策略。
- 可验证性:区块链游戏中的所有操作都必须可验证,即任何玩家都可以通过区块链上的记录来证明其行为的合法性。
- 去中心化:区块链游戏通过去中心化的方式,避免了传统游戏中的单点故障和信任问题。
区块链游戏的创新与价值
区块链游戏的出现为游戏行业带来了许多创新和价值:
- NFT的应用:区块链游戏是NFT(非同质化代币)的典型应用之一,NFT可以代表游戏中的虚拟资产,如角色、道具、土地等,这些NFT可以在区块链上进行交易和展示。
- 虚拟资产的交易:区块链游戏为虚拟资产的交易提供了新的平台,玩家可以通过区块链游戏获得虚拟资产,这些资产可以用于购买游戏内物品、参与代币发行等。
- 游戏中的去中心化:区块链游戏通过去中心化的方式,打破了传统游戏中的信任依赖,玩家可以通过区块链上的记录证明其行为的合法性,从而增强游戏的可信度。
- 经济价值:区块链游戏为游戏运营商提供了新的盈利模式,通过发行代币、吸引NFT买家、推广虚拟资产交易,区块链游戏可以为游戏运营商带来新的经济价值。
区块链游戏的挑战与未来展望
尽管区块链游戏具有许多创新和价值,但其发展也面临一些挑战:
- 技术复杂性:区块链游戏的技术复杂性较高,需要玩家具备一定的技术背景知识,这可能会限制普通玩家的参与度。
- 用户接受度:区块链技术本身具有较高的技术门槛,这可能会导致用户接受度不高,区块链游戏需要通过创新和营销来提高玩家的参与度。
- 监管问题:区块链游戏涉及虚拟资产交易,这需要相关部门进行监管,如何在保护玩家权益和促进行业发展之间找到平衡点,是一个需要解决的问题。
- 去中心化的实现:区块链游戏的去中心化特性需要通过技术手段来实现,如何确保区块链游戏的去中心化特性得到充分体现,是一个需要深入研究的问题。
区块链游戏是区块链技术与游戏行业的深度融合产物,它利用区块链的去中心化、不可篡改性和智能合约等特性,为游戏行业带来了新的可能性,区块链游戏不仅为玩家提供了新的娱乐方式,也为游戏运营商带来了新的盈利模式,区块链游戏的发展也面临技术复杂性、用户接受度和监管等问题,随着区块链技术的不断发展和创新,区块链游戏将在娱乐、经济和文化等领域发挥更大的作用。
发表评论